AMBER JEWELRY
Amber rocks, which are formed from fossilized tree resin, are a much-sought-after treasure of Poland. The origins of these precious stones are found in the Baltic Sea, coastal areas of the country, and the surrounding region. Amber can be found in many areas along the Polish coastline, but the most prized stones are found in the Sambia Peninsula, located in the northern part of the country. Sambian amber is known for its golden hue and is considered to be the finest in the world.
Once extracted from the coast, the amber is carefully processed and sorted into different grades, which are then sold to jewelers all over the world. The amber is also used to create beautiful jewelry pieces, such as necklaces, rings, and earrings. The amber rocks of Poland are renowned for their beauty and have been treasured for centuries.
